Pengaruh intervensi Mindfulness-Based Stress Reduction (MBSR) terhadap kecenderungan baby blues pada ibu postpartum

Nur Arrad Tenri Gangka,
Widyastuti,
Kartika Cahyaningrum

Abstract: Baby blues are a common disorder experienced by women in the postpartum period. Baby blues are classified as mild postpartum depression but if left untreated can develop into postpartum depression. Mindfulness-Based Stress Reduction (MBSR) is an intervention used to treat various psychological disorders such as stress, anxiety, and postpartum depression.
